Introduction
Poker is an extensively well-known card game that integrates ability, method, and a bit of opportunity. With numerous variants like Texas Hold'em, Omaha, and Seven-Card Stud, poker provides players a fantastic and competitive gaming knowledge. To achieve poker, people must develop efficient methods that optimize their particular decision making abilities, and in turn, boost their particular likelihood of winning. This report explores some secret poker strategies, emphasizing the significance of knowing the online game, reading opponents, handling bankroll, and strategic decision-making.

Knowing the Game
One of the fundamental aspects of poker strategy is having a comprehensive comprehension of the video game and its principles. People must certanly be acquainted with hand positions, gambling frameworks, and prospective results. By learning the game's principles, players could make informed decisions and strategize efficiently, analyzing the chances and possible incentives.

Reading Opponents
An essential part of poker strategy could be the ability to review opponents and decipher their particular playing types and actions. This ability allows players to gain insight into their opponents' hands, enabling all of them to regulate their own techniques accordingly. Observing gestures, betting patterns, and verbal cues are important components of successfully reading opponents in poker.

Managing Bankroll
Effective money administration is paramount to sustained success in poker. People must set clear limits on the spending, just gambling with cash they can manage to drop. It is wise to separate poker resources from private finances and keep a stringent budget. By managing their particular bankroll sensibly, people can mitigate dangers and also make well-informed choices without dropping into the traps of careless wagering.

Strategic Decision-Making
Strategic decision-making is at the core of poker methods. People have to analyze several aspects, such as the power of their own hand, dining table dynamics, position, while the behavior of opponents. As an example, following an aggressive method is a great idea when keeping strong cards, as it can intimidate opponents and force all of them to fold. Alternatively, an even more conservative strategy might proper when dealt weaker arms, limiting potential losses. Finally, the capacity to adjust while making strategic choices predicated on these facets is essential to achieve your goals.

Bluffing and Deception
A well-executed bluff is a strong device in poker strategy, permitting people to win pots with weaker hands. Bluffing requires deceiving opponents giving them untrue impressions of this player's hand energy or intentions. However, bluffing should be approached cautiously and selectively, as excessive bluffing can reduce its effectiveness and result in monetary losings.

Acknowledging and Exploiting Habits
Understanding patterns in opponents' behavior and wagering can provide important ideas within their techniques. Skilled players can exploit these patterns by modifying their strategies accordingly. For example, if a person over repeatedly raises pre-flop but often folds after the flop, other players can take advantage of this predictability by modifying their own strategies to take advantage of the situation. Acknowledging and exploiting such patterns will give people a significant edge during the poker table.
